Hi, I'm using C++ on QNX 6.3.2 and I got a segfault when doing "<<" in a ostringstream.
I've had a similar problem before[1] but it was because some library I was linking to was compiled against Dinkumware C+
+ Library and GNU C++ library, and there is a problem with Dinkumware C++ Library and multi-threaded programs (my
program is multi-thread). This problem in the library I was linking to was fixed (only links against GNU C++ if I'm not
wrong), but now I'm hitting a strange segfault too. Here is the backtrace:
